Output 48e8568f12546ee14640b1f4d39fc9c0aa8c5ff5b3d32d6d60f147bafdf562aa:0

value
11795159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43775b79b19358f7ff8223eb9dbc070324c3dbb5 OP_EQUAL
address
37qkBVJThAYSzsBzNaGQwtushfP2MhT4NE
transaction
48e8568f12546ee14640b1f4d39fc9c0aa8c5ff5b3d32d6d60f147bafdf562aa
confirmations
289102
spent
true